SINGAPORE, Feb. 9, 2021 /PRNewswire/ YouTrip, Singapore’s leading multi-currency mobile wallet has unveiled a Chinese New Year guarantee of up to S$888 cashback when users send an e-hongbao through YouTrip’s newly released peer-to-peer transfer feature.

The feature allows users to send money safely and instantly in any of the 10 wallet currencies including SGD, USD, GBP and AUD.

From 9 to 26 February 2021, users will be rewarded with a random cashback reward ranging from S$0.80 to S$888 for each of their first three transfers with no minimum amount required.

This feature release is also in line with the Monetary Authority of Singapore’s efforts to encourage e-gifting during this festive period to reduce queues and support the environment.

Caecilia Chu, Co-Founder and CEO of YouTrip shares: “With our latest feature, we’re encouraged that we’re able to connect our users with their family and friends who might not be physically around to celebrate the festivities. This Chinese New Year gave YouTrip a chance to tap on our payment solution expertise to keep our users safe while celebrating with an extra perk. Apart from gifting e-hongbaos, we’re looking forward to how our users will benefit from this feature for their online purchases, as well as travel spending when travel rebounds.”

Sending an e-hongbao to another YouTrip user only requires 3 steps:

1)    Tap on “Send” button on the app home screen
2)    Search for a friend on YouTrip by name or phone number
3)    Select the currency and enter the amount the user wants to send.
